如何自己搭建畅邮服务器
-
畅邮服务器的搭建可以帮助个人或组织实现更好的邮件管理和邮件服务控制。下面将介绍如何自己搭建畅邮服务器的步骤:
-
选择适合的服务器操作系统:畅邮服务器可以在多种操作系统上运行,如Linux、Windows等。选择适合的操作系统是搭建畅邮服务器的第一步。
-
安装必要的依赖软件:在服务器上安装必要的依赖软件,如邮件服务软件(如Postfix、Exim等)、数据库(如MySQL、MariaDB等)以及其他辅助软件(如Apache、Nginx等)。
-
配置邮件服务软件:通过修改邮件服务软件的配置文件,对邮件服务进行必要的配置,如设置邮件数据存储路径、设置邮件发件人身份验证、设置邮件收发规则等。
-
配置数据库:创建并配置所需的数据库,用于存储邮件收发相关的数据,如邮件账户、邮件收件箱等。
-
配置DNS服务:在服务器上配置域名解析服务(如BIND),将域名与服务器的IP地址进行绑定,从而实现邮件服务的访问。
-
配置安全性:在畅邮服务器上配置各种安全措施,如设置防火墙、启用SSL/TLS加密等,以确保邮件数据的安全性。
-
测试和调试:完成以上步骤后,进行测试和调试,确保邮件服务能正常运行,包括发送和接收邮件、设置自动转发和自动回复等功能。
-
备份和监控:定期进行邮件数据的备份,并设置相关的监控措施,以便及时发现和解决问题。
搭建畅邮服务器需要一定的技术知识和经验,如果对此不太熟悉,建议寻求专业人员的帮助或选择使用已经搭建好的邮件服务提供商。
1年前 -
-
搭建自己的畅邮(Mail Server)服务器可以让您完全掌控自己的电子邮件系统。这样您就可以自由地创建和管理电子邮件账户,发送和接收电子邮件。下面是搭建畅邮服务器的几个步骤:
-
选择操作系统和邮件服务器软件:
首先,您需要选择一个操作系统作为服务器的基础。常见的选择有Linux服务器操作系统,如Ubuntu、CentOS等。然后,您需要选择一个邮件服务器软件。常见的选择有Postfix、Exim、Sendmail等。 -
获取并配置域名:
在搭建畅邮服务器之前,您需要拥有一个域名并将其指向服务器的IP地址。您可以通过向域名注册商购买一个域名,并在其管理界面设置域名解析记录来完成这个步骤。 -
安装和配置邮件服务器软件:
根据您选择的邮件服务器软件,按照官方文档或在线教程来安装并配置它。通常,您需要设置主机名、域名、SMTP和POP3/IMAP协议等参数。 -
配置SSL证书:
SSL证书可以确保邮件的安全传输。您可以通过向SSL证书厂商购买证书,并按照官方文档来安装和配置SSL证书。 -
添加邮件账户和配置客户端:
在成功搭建并配置畅邮服务器后,您可以通过管理界面添加和配置邮件账户。然后,您可以使用任意支持SMTP和POP3/IMAP协议的邮件客户端来连接和使用这些账户。
此外,还有一些其他的注意事项和建议,包括:
- 定期备份邮件数据,以防止数据丢失。
- 配置反垃圾邮件(Anti-Spam)和反病毒(Anti-Virus)软件,以提高邮件安全性。
- 合理配置服务器的硬件资源,如磁盘空间、内存和处理器核心等。
- 定期更新服务器软件和操作系统,以保持系统的稳定性和安全性。
- 参考相关的文档和教程,积极参与邮件服务器社区的讨论和支持。
总之,搭建畅邮服务器需要一些技术知识和经验。如果您不熟悉这方面的技术,建议您寻求专业人士的帮助或选择使用第三方邮件服务提供商。
1年前 -
-
自己搭建一台畅邮服务器可以为个人、企业等提供高效、可靠的邮件服务。搭建畅邮服务器需要进行一系列的配置和操作,下面以 CentOS 7 操作系统为例,介绍如何自己搭建畅邮服务器。
准备工作
在开始搭建畅邮服务器之前,需要准备以下工作:
- 一台具备公网 IP 的服务器,可以是虚拟机也可以是物理机。
- 注册一个可用的域名,并将域名解析指向服务器的公网 IP。
- 确保服务器上已经安装了 CentOS 7 操作系统,并且可以正常联网。
安装配置邮件服务器软件
- 使用管理员权限登录到 CentOS 7 的服务器。
- 更新系统软件包:
$ sudo yum update -y - 安装邮件服务器软件:
$ sudo yum install -y postfix dovecot opendkim opendmarc spamassassin clamav clamav-update
配置 Postfix
- 打开 Postfix 配置文件进行编辑:
$ sudo vi /etc/postfix/main.cf - 确保以下配置项的值被正确设置:
- myhostname: 设置为服务器的域名。
- mynetworks: 设置允许发送邮件的 IP 段,一般设置为局域网的 IP 段,例如 192.168.0.0/24。
- mydestination: 设置为服务器的域名。
- inet_interfaces: 设置为 all,允许任何 IP 都可以使用 Postfix 接受传入的邮件。
- relay_domains: 设置为 $mydestination,指定 Postfix 接受本地邮件。
- relayhost: 如果需要将邮件转发到其他邮件服务器,可以设置此选项。
- 保存并关闭文件。
配置 Dovecot
- 打开 Dovecot 配置文件进行编辑:
$ sudo vi /etc/dovecot/dovecot.conf - 将以下配置项的注释符号(#)去掉,并设置为正确的值:
- hostname: 设置为服务器的域名。
- protocols: 设置为 imap pop3,启用访问邮件的协议。
- 保存并关闭文件。
配置 DKIM
- 生成 DKIM 密钥对:
$ sudo opendkim-genkey -b 2048 -d yourdomain.com -s mail -D /etc/opendkim/keys/将 yourdomain.com 替换为你的域名。
- 设置 DKIM 密钥文件的权限:
$ sudo chown opendkim:opendkim /etc/opendkim/keys/mail.private$ sudo chmod 600 /etc/opendkim/keys/mail.private - 打开 DKIM 配置文件进行编辑:
$ sudo vi /etc/opendkim.conf - 将以下配置项的注释符号(#)去掉,并设置为正确的值:
- Domain: 设置为你的域名。
- KeyFile: 设置为 /etc/opendkim/keys/mail.private。
- Selector: 设置为 mail(与生成 DKIM 密钥对时的参数一致)。
- 保存并关闭文件。
配置 DMARC
- 打开 DMARC 配置文件进行编辑:
$ sudo vi /etc/opendmarc.conf - 将以下配置项的注释符号(#)去掉,并设置为正确的值:
- AuthservID: 设置为你的域名。
- TrustedAuthservIDs: 设置为你信任的邮件服务器的域名。
- RejectFailures: 如果你不想接受 DMARC 认证失败的邮件,设置为 true。
- 保存并关闭文件。
启动服务
- 启动邮件服务:
$ sudo systemctl start postfix$ sudo systemctl start dovecot$ sudo systemctl start opendkim$ sudo systemctl start opendmarc - 设置服务自启动:
$ sudo systemctl enable postfix$ sudo systemctl enable dovecot$ sudo systemctl enable opendkim$ sudo systemctl enable opendmarc
配置防火墙
- 开启 SMTP、IMAP、POP3、DKIM、DMARC 等相关端口:
$ sudo firewall-cmd --permanent --add-service=smtp$ sudo firewall-cmd --permanent --add-service=imap$ sudo firewall-cmd --permanent --add-service=pop3$ sudo firewall-cmd --permanent --add-port=8891/tcp$ sudo firewall-cmd --permanent --add-port=8893/tcp - 重新加载防火墙规则:
$ sudo firewall-cmd --reload
至此,畅邮服务器的搭建已经完成。你可以使用邮件客户端配置邮件账户,测试发送和接收邮件。记得定期更新邮件服务器软件包和病毒库,保证服务器的安全性。
请注意,本指南提供的方法适用于 CentOS 7 操作系统,不同的操作系统和版本可能有所不同,请根据具体情况进行调整。
1年前